WASHINGTON (AP) — Japan and the Netherlands have agreed to a take care of the U.S. to prohibit China’s entry to supplies used to make superior pc chips, an individual aware of the settlement informed The Associated Press on Sunday.
The individual declined to be recognized as a result of the deal hasn’t but been formally introduced. It’s unclear when all three sides will unveil the settlement. The White House declined to remark.
The Biden administration in October imposed export controls to restrict China’s capacity to entry superior chips, which it says can be utilized to make weapons, commit human rights abuses and enhance the pace and accuracy of its navy logistics. It urged allies like Japan and the Netherlands to observe swimsuit.
China has responded angrily, saying commerce curbs will disrupt provide chains and the worldwide financial restoration.
“We hope the related nations will do the suitable factor and work collectively to uphold the multilateral commerce regime and safeguard the steadiness of the worldwide industrial and provide chains,” China’s Foreign Ministry spokesperson Wang Wenbin stated earlier this month. “This may also serve to shield their very own long-term pursuits.”
White House National Security Council spokesman John Kirby stated Friday that Dutch and Japanese officers had been in Washington for talks led by President Joe Biden’s nationwide safety adviser, Jake Sullivan, that coated the “security and safety of rising applied sciences,” efforts to help Ukraine and different points.
“We’re grateful that they had been in a position to come to D.C. and to have these talks,” Kirby stated.
Kirby declined to say whether or not there was a deal on tighter export controls on semiconductor know-how. This month, Biden met individually with Japanese Prime Minister Fumio Kishida and Dutch Prime Minister Mark Rutte to push for tighter export controls.
In a press convention final week, Rutte was requested in regards to the talks however stated they contain “such delicate materials … high-quality know-how that the Dutch authorities chooses to talk about it very rigorously and meaning in a really restricted manner.”
Veldhoven, Netherlands-based ASML, a number one maker of semiconductor manufacturing gear, stated Sunday that it didn’t know any particulars in regards to the settlement or how it could have an effect on ASML’s enterprise.
ASML is the world’s solely producer of machines that use excessive ultraviolet lithography to make superior semiconductor chips. The Dutch authorities has prohibited ASML from exporting that gear to China since 2019, however the firm had nonetheless been delivery lower-quality lithography techniques to China.
ASML has analysis and manufacturing facilities in Beijing and Shenzhen, China, in addition to a regional headquarters in Hong Kong.
U.S. officers say China is spending closely to develop its fledgling semiconductor producers however to date can not make the high-end chips utilized in essentially the most superior smartphones and different gadgets.
